Wedding Belles: Wedding Day Emergency Kit

Hey y'all!

It has been a long while since I have posted a wedding blog, but since so many of my friends are getting hitched this season I wanted to give a couple of posts dedicated to my favorite topic!

Today's post is all about my wedding day essentials/a.k.a an emergency kit for the day of!

On my big day one of my most used things was our basket.
My maids and I kept it in our suite while we got ready & ended up using several things from it, & then before the ceremony started, we left it in the guest bathroom. There was also a men's version which was the same, minus the girly essentials!

Some of the most-used items were bobby pins (duh!) I think I may have used half the pack for my own up-do!

Girly products are also perfect to keep on-hand, I love the green package pictured above-they're called Sweet Spot wipes (you can get them from Target!) & they're great for cleansing sweat & more.

Another great essential is Evian facial spray: it's perfect for blending makeup, helping re-style your hair, and keeping you cool.
Even in the fall, down in Alabama it's still warm so keeping cool is a must.

The best part about this emergency kit basket is that after the night is over, you can take all of these items with you on your honeymoon because they're all TSA travel-approved sizes!

Here's a comprehensive list:

Band-Aids (a must for any boo-boos!)
Ice Breakers mints (keeps bad breath at bay)
Tide to Go Pen (perfect for wine stains)
Pantene Air Spray (This is my favorite hair-spray because it doesn't have alcohol in it, which means it doesn't dry your hair out & doesn't make it crunchy)
Dove Spray Deodorant (This is perfect for people to share because it doesn't touch anyones sweaty armpits, but keeps everyone fresh)
Off! Bug-Repellant (this is necessary for outdoor weddings!)
Evian Spray (This can be used in a million different ways, it's a necessity!)
Lotion (a great smelling lotion is the perfect treat)
Band-Aid Friction Block (Y'all, this is a miracle drug. You slide it on your heels and it keeps your shoes from rubbing)
Kotex (Must-haves for all the ladies at your big day)
Nail File
Aleve
Toothpicks (Get the mint-flavored ones!)
Sweet Spot Wipes
Lint Roller
Bobby Pins

On Sunday, I shared one of my favorite snacks-an iced coffee (in my favorite Lilly tumbler no-less!) and some yummy granola.

This granola is actually one of my favorite snack finds that I've stumbled upon lately.
It's by a company called Luv Michael & it is not just a tasty snack.
This company was born from an 18 year old boy who has autism.
Michael loved to cook, but was unable to attend culinary school because of his lack of a high school diploma. Luv Michael was born as a way of expressing his love of cooking as well as allowing other individuals with autism to gain vocational training.

Other than the positive message of this company-which is amazing in itself-the granola tastes so good!
It's like your mother's oatmeal cookies, but even better because it's Gluten Free, Nut Free, GMO Free so that means lots of people can enjoy it!
My second favorite way to enjoy it (other than just plain!) is crumbled up on top of greek yogurt with a touch of honey, it's so yummy!
